Exploring Resilient Operation of Multi-Robot Fleet in Various Attack Scenarios

Résumé

In the era of autonomous robotics and the prolifer- ation of robot fleets, the reliability of these systems in the face of potential disruptions becomes a critical consideration. This paper focuses on examining the resilience of robotic fleets, specifically at the communication layer. Through a systematic exploration of various communication-based attack scenarios, the study seeks to unravel vulnerabilities and challenges in maintaining seamless communication within the fleet. The findings aim to contribute in- sights into fortifying the communication infrastructure of robotic fleets, thereby enhancing their overall resilience in dynamic and potentially adversarial environments. This research aims towards advancing the robustness of autonomous systems and ensuring their dependable operation across diverse applications.
